編集の要約なし |
|||
17行目: | 17行目: | ||
===標準拡張=== | ===標準拡張=== | ||
* [[javax.crypto のクラスたち|javax.crypto パッケージ]] - 暗号化を担当してくれるクラスたち | * [[javax.crypto のクラスたち|javax.crypto パッケージ]] - 暗号化を担当してくれるクラスたち | ||
* [[javax.xml のクラスたち|javax.xml パッケージ]] - JAXP(Java API for XML Processing) |
2019年7月2日 (火) 23:28時点における版
< Java
Java の世界には沢山の標準クラスたち(3,500以上)がおり、あなたのプロジェクトに採用されるのを今か今かと待っている。その1つ1つが天才たちの人生が詰め込まれたレバレッジ。利用頻度の高い順に、出来るだけ大勢のクラスたちに精通することがJavaプログラミングのコツ。クラス図鑑。
- java.lang パッケージ - 基本的なクラスたち。インポート不要
- java.util パッケージ - 一般的な仕事をしてくれるクラスたち
- java.time パッケージ - 日時操作を担当してくれるクラスたち(Java8以降)
- java.text パッケージ - テキスト処理を担当してくれるクラスたち
- java.math パッケージ - 計算など数学を担当してくれるクラスたち
外部リソースの活用
- java.net パッケージ - ネットワーク通信を担当してくれるクラスたち
- java.sql パッケージ - データベース操作を担当してくれるクラスたち
- java.nio パッケージ - 「java.io パッケージ」の新しいバージョン
- java.io パッケージ - データの入出力を担当してくれるクラスたち
標準拡張
- javax.crypto パッケージ - 暗号化を担当してくれるクラスたち
- javax.xml パッケージ - JAXP(Java API for XML Processing)